    Quote Originally Posted by upstatedoc View Post
    RK-

    What did you paint the cups with? My GTI doesn't have a tint strip and my clear cups stick out like a sore thumb.
    I have a tint strip on my Volvo, but its fairly faint, and narrow (only a small width at the top of the windshield). The reason the black suction cups work well, is because mine is right in line with my rear view mirror, so black on black is hard to see.

    I just used a standard matte black spray paint, and painted the outside (not the mounting surface of the cup). I think it'd be almost undetectable if you could blacken BOTH sides of the suction cup..or buy black ones. The paint I used remained slightly sticky even at the end of the day. I havent touch them again to check, but had I thought of it ahead of time, I would've used a HIGH TEMP spray paint in hopes that it wouldnt soften it the heat of the sun everyday.
